Yes, ISO1410 is pin-to-pin compatible with ADM2483BRWZ with just one difference on Pin7 which is PV for ADM2483 and is NC for ISO1410. Device ADM2843 requires the PV pin to be driven by LOW during power-up to avoid some chatter on A/B pins. While ISO1410 doesn't have any such restriction and there is no such need for PV pin to maintain chatter free data transmission on A/B. Hence, this is not connected internally to device and named NC (Not Connected).
Hence, replacing ADM2483 with ISO1410 should be just fine. Even if customer application has some PV logic implemented, applying such a signal to ISO1410 doesn't affect the device and will continue work without any issues.

Sorry, I missed to address your question on MAX2202x.
We do not have a P2P device for MAX2202x family but ISO1410 should meet most of MAX2202x specs, though in a different package. We also have ISO1500 which is an RS-485 isolator in a smaller package, maybe this is of interest to customer. Please do check if either of these devices can be used. Thanks.
